PostgreSQL Connection

Specifies the options for connecting to PostgreSQL databases.

DBMS/driver-specific connection string

Enter the driver specific connection string. The connection string is sequence of keyword/value pairs separated by spaces. For example dbname=MyDatabase host=myHost port=5432 where dbname: the name of the database hosted in the DBMS server. host: the fully qualified name of the RDBMS server port: the server port. The default port for PostgreSQL is 5432. You can also enter the connection string as postgresql://myHost:port/MyDatabase. Refer to the database server administrator for the correct values of the keywords passed in the connection string. Values for user= and password= are ignored but will be requested at connection time. The connection string is displayed in the %PRODUCTNAME Base status bar.
